摘要:

文章依据2000-2008年北京市土地利用数据,从生态系统服务功能角度运用Costanza的方法,参照谢高地陆地生态系统单位服务价值当量表,分析了北京生态服务价值与土地利用变化的响应关系。结果表明:由于建设用地急剧增长,耕地和水域面积大幅度减少,北京生态系统服务价值在8年间减少了51824.4万元,年均变化率为-0.31%;从空间来看,密云县、怀柔区和中心城区生态系统服务价值最高,相对应生态系统服务价值最低的区域则分别是通州区、顺义区和大兴区;土地利用结构变化决定着生态系统结构和功能(生态系统服务价值)的变化。因此规划部门在制定规划时应更多地考虑到生态服务价值的重要意义,更多的保护水域、林地等具备高生态价值的生态用地,实现北京各区域的可持续发展。

Abstract:

Based on land use data in 2000 and 2008, with the Costanza’s method and the coefficients proposed by Gao-di Xie, this paper examined the effects of land use change on ecosystem services value from the perspective of ecosystem services. Results indicated that the cultivated land and water area have decreased largely with the rapid increase of construction land. The ecosystem services value of Beijing has decreased by 518.244 million yuan, with the annual percent change of 4.87%.From the Perspective of Space,Miyun County、Huairou District and the central area of Beijing have the maximal value, and Tongzhou District、Shunyi District and Daxing District have the least value. The change of land use structure determines the changes of ecosystem structure and function. As a result, ecosystem services value is recommended to be taken into account in the formulation of land use planning, especially the conservation of water and woodland of high coefficients of ecosystem services value in order to achieve sustainable development of Beijing.
